Breakthrough ACTION leverages social and behavior change (SBC) approaches to increase modern family planning (FP) access and informed, voluntary use in Burkina Faso, Côte d’Ivoire, Niger, and Togo. This technical brief, available in English and French, shares promising, proven, or innovative program approaches that can yield FP results in the West Africa region by providing a deep dive into three distinct activities:

  • Community dialogues and facility site walkthroughs, a multi-sectoral and community engagement approach to improve FP service quality via community-driven solutions.
  • FP provider behavior change tools to respond to regional and country-specific challenges identified to offer quality FP services.
  • The Confiance Totale (Total Confidence) radio campaign, which fostered trust in FP services and methods during the COVID-19 pandemic.
